FujiFilm JZ300 vs Samsung DV150F Physical Comparison
For anybody who is going to carry your camera regularly, you have to think about its weight and volume. The FujiFilm JZ300 enjoys outside measurements of 97mm x 57mm x 29mm (3.8" x 2.2" x 1.1") having a weight of 168 grams (0.37 lbs) and the Samsung DV150F has sizing of 96mm x 55mm x 18mm (3.8" x 2.2" x 0.7") having a weight of 116 grams (0.26 lbs).

FujiFilm JZ300 vs Samsung DV150F Sensor Comparison
More often than not, it is tough to visualise the contrast between sensor sizing just by going over a spec sheet. The visual here may offer you a clearer sense of the sensor measurements in the JZ300 and DV150F.
Clearly, both of those cameras have got the exact same sensor measurements albeit not the same resolution. You should count on the Samsung DV150F to offer you greater detail having its extra 4 Megapixels. Higher resolution can also enable you to crop pictures much more aggressively. The older JZ300 is going to be disadvantaged with regard to sensor innovation.
